NURS 499 - Prof Development in Nursing

Institution:
Lander University
Subject:
Nursing
Description:
This course is an examination of nursing's present dynamics and future directions with emphasis on professional development, career structuring, and advanced preparation in nursing. The course incorporates legal and ethical codes of professional nursing practice as well as current issues in nursing, health and the health care delivery system through the investigation and critical analysis of information from various sources. Topics may vary depending on current issues. Prerequisites: Grade of "C" or better in NURS 345, NURS 346, and NURS 393. This course is taken in final year of nursing coursework. Two credit hours (2,0).
